Hi everyone, my name is Isabella! Today, we're going to look at a very special painting called "Composition in Red, Yellow and Blue." It was painted by an artist named Piet Mondrian a long, long time ago, in 1922! nn What colors do you see in the painting? That's right, red, yellow, and blue! nn Now, look closely. What shapes do you see? Yes, squares and rectangles! Mondrian loved using simple shapes and colors in his paintings. nn Do you think this painting looks like anything in the real world, like a house or a tree? Not really, right? That's because Mondrian wasn't trying to paint something real. He wanted to show us how beautiful colors and shapes can be all on their own! nn He believed that these simple things could create a feeling of balance and peace. What do you think? Does this painting make you feel calm and balanced? nn Mondrian's paintings are like puzzles, but instead of putting pieces together, he's showing us how beautiful simple shapes and colors can be when you put them together in a special way. nn Let's take a closer look at how the colors and shapes work together. What do you notice about the big red line at the bottom? And how about that tiny white square hiding under the yellow one? nn Mondrian wanted us to really see and think about these colors and shapes. He wanted his art to be like a breath of fresh air, clean and simple. nn Even though this painting is old, it still feels modern and exciting today. That's because Mondrian's ideas about art were way ahead of his time! nn Now that we've spent some time with this amazing painting, what do you like most about it?
